Connecting Eufy S220 to Apple HomeKit
To add your Eufy S220 to Apple HomeKit, ensure that your device supports the platform and that you have the latest firmware installed. Follow these steps for a smooth setup process:
- Open the Eufy Security app on your smartphone.
- Navigate to the device settings for your Eufy S220.
- Tap on the "Add to Apple Home" option.
- Scan the HomeKit QR code provided with your device or in the app.
- Follow the on-screen prompts to complete the pairing process.
Once connected, you can control your Eufy S220 through the Apple Home app, Siri voice commands, and automate its functions within your HomeKit ecosystem.
Connecting Eufy S220 to Google Assistant
Integrating your Eufy S220 with Google Assistant expands your control options and allows for voice commands and routines. Here's how to connect your device:
- Open the Google Home app on your smartphone.
- Tap the "+" icon to add a new device or service.
- Select "Set up device" and then choose "Works with Google."
- Search for "Eufy Security" in the list of compatible services.
- Log in with your Eufy account credentials to authorize access.
- Follow the prompts to link your Eufy S220 to Google Assistant.
After linking, your Eufy S220 can be controlled via voice commands like "Hey Google, show the front door camera" and integrated into routines for automation.
Tips for a Successful Integration
- Ensure your smart home hubs and devices are on the same Wi-Fi network.
- Keep your device firmware and app versions up to date.
- Use strong, unique passwords for your accounts.
- Consult the official Eufy support resources for troubleshooting.
